    Title
    Flag Forge has ReDoS Vulnerability in User Profile Lookup API
    Summary
    Flag Forge is a Capture The Flag (CTF) platform. Versions 2.3.2 and below have a Regular Expression Denial of Service (ReDoS) vulnerability in the user profile API endpoint (/api/user/[username]). The application constructs a regular expression dynamically using unescaped user input (the username parameter). An attacker can exploit this by sending a specially crafted username containing regex meta-characters (e.g., deeply nested groups or quantifiers), causing the MongoDB regex engine to consume excessive CPU resources. This can lead to Denial of Service for other users. The issue is fixed in version 2.3.3. To workaround this issue, implement a Web Application Firewall (WAF) rule to block requests containing regex meta-characters in the URL path.

    Title
    FlagForge Allows Unauthenticated Badge Template API Access
    Summary
    Flag Forge is a Capture The Flag (CTF) platform. Starting in version 2.0.0 and prior to version 2.3.2, the `/api/admin/badge-templates` (GET) and `/api/admin/badge-templates/create` (POST) endpoints previously allowed access without authentication or authorization. This could have enabled unauthorized users to retrieve all badge templates and sensitive metadata (createdBy, createdAt, updatedAt) and/or create arbitrary badge templates in the database. This could lead to data exposure, database pollution, or abuse of the badge system. The issue has been fixed in FlagForge v2.3.2. GET, POST, UPDATE, and DELETE endpoints now require authentication. Authorization checks ensure only admins can access and modify badge templates. No reliable workarounds are available.

    Title
    FlagForgeCTF Unauthenticated Resource Modification/Deletion
    Summary
    Flag Forge is a Capture The Flag (CTF) platform. From versions 2.0.0 to before 2.3.1, the /api/resources endpoint previously allowed POST and DELETE requests without proper authentication or authorization. This could have enabled unauthorized users to create, modify, or delete resources on the platform. The issue has been fixed in FlagForge version 2.3.1.

    Title
    FlagForgeCTF Exposes User Emails via Public /api/user/[username] API
    Summary
    Flag Forge is a Capture The Flag (CTF) platform. From versions 2.0.0 to before 2.3.2, the public endpoint /api/user/[username] returns user email addresses in its JSON response. The fix, intended for release in 2.3.1 but only available starting in version 2.3.2, removes email addresses from public API responses while keeping the endpoint publicly accessible. Users should upgrade to version 2.3.2 or later to eliminate exposure. There are no workarounds for this vulnerability.

    Title
    FlagForgeCTF's Improper Session Handling Allows Access After Logout
    Summary
    Flag Forge is a Capture The Flag (CTF) platform. In versions from 2.2.0 to before 2.3.1, the FlagForge web application improperly handles session invalidation. Authenticated users can continue to access protected endpoints, such as /api/profile, even after logging out. CSRF tokens are also still valid post-logout, which can allow unauthorized actions. This issue has been patched in version 2.3.1.

    Title
    FlagForgeCTF Hint Exposure via API
    Summary
    Flag Forge is a Capture The Flag (CTF) platform. In versions from 2.1.0 to before 2.3.0, the API endpoint GET /api/problems/:id returns challenge hints in plaintext within the question object, regardless of whether the user has unlocked them via point deduction. Users can view all hints for free, undermining the business logic of the platform and reducing the integrity of the challenge system. This issue has been patched in version 2.3.0.

    Title
    FlagForgeCTF is Missing Authorization in main-v2
    Summary
    Flag Forge is a Capture The Flag (CTF) platform. In version 2.1.0, the /api/admin/assign-badge endpoint lacks proper access control, allowing any authenticated user to assign high-privilege badges (e.g., Staff) to themselves. This could lead to privilege escalation and impersonation of administrative roles. This issue has been patched in version 2.2.0.

    Title
    FlagForgeCTF Vulnerable to Unauthorized Problem Creation
    Summary
    Flag Forge is a Capture The Flag (CTF) platform. In version 2.1.0, non-admin users can create arbitrary challenges, potentially introducing malicious, incorrect, or misleading content. This issue has been patched in version 2.2.0.
